How much does it cost to rent a home in South Sarasota?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Sarasota 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,509 | $1,195 | $10,000+ |
| South Sarasota 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,233 | $1,399 | $10,000+ |
| South Sarasota 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,347 | $1,600 | $10,000+ |
| South Sarasota 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,334 | $2,500 | $10,000+ |
| South Sarasota 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$25,200 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about South Sarasota
What type of rentals are currently available in South Sarasota?
There are currently 730 Apartments for Rent in South Sarasota,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,050 to $17,313. There are also 1434 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in South Sarasota ranging from $950 to $45,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in South Sarasota?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in South Sarasota ranges from $950 to $45,000 with an average monthly rent of $8,383.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in South Sarasota?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in South Sarasota range from $1,250 to $17,313,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,399 to $25,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,600 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,050.
